  7. We will be sailing a 10days Queensland followed by a 30day Transpacific form Syd to Yvr. Confused when the onboard currency will change over from AUD to USD. We have cards from AARP as well as Princess Credit card to add as OBC. In previous B2B our folio has carried over and not cashed out after 1st leg. I've read about the exchange rate converting on a non favorable rate. I would think the best thing to do is to deposit the cards into our account later in the cruise as to avoid the conversion. I could see how depositing them early would cause 2 conversions and there's no way I'd trust Princess to get it right. Anyone have experience that can advise.
